DMRC introduces early 5:15 AM metro for Chhath Puja devotees returning to Delhi | Details
New Delhi: The Delhi Metro Rail Corporation (DMRC) has announced special early morning services to make travel easier for passengers returning to the capital after celebrating the Chhath festival. The facility, which began on Wednesday, October 30, will continue until November 3, providing commuters with additional convenience during the busy festive period.
According to an official notice issued by the DMRC, metro services will begin at 5:15 AM from two key stations, Anand Vihar and New Delhi Railway Station, for five consecutive days. The decision has been taken in view of the large number of passengers arriving in Delhi from Bihar and eastern Uttar Pradesh, many of whom depend on the metro for onward travel within the city.
